The regulatory framework surrounding pokie machines varies slightly between states and territories in Australia. Each jurisdiction has its own laws regarding the operation, licensing, and taxation of these machines. This means that rules about how machines are designed, the maximum bet sizes allowed, and the payout return percentages can differ depending on where you are. Staying informed about the specific regulations applicable to your location is essential for responsible gambling and a safe experience.

Responsible gambling is paramount when playing Australian pokie machines. Before playing, set a budget and stick to it, regardless of the outcomes. It's often helpful to view gambling as a form of entertainment rather than as a means of earning money. Knowing the odds and understanding that the house always has an edge is also critical. If you find yourself struggling with gambling habits, seek help from professional services that can provide support and guidance.
